This was made while out with Jeremy Moore on Friday, looking for churches for the project. We came across an old church, just about falling down. Next to it was an arbor, with this old piano in a cabinet...Jeremy will have some much better work I would guess, but this one worked (at least IMO). It was a rough day of shooting, the lens for the 8x10 decided not to work, then the spot meter batteries died....such are the days :)
Location
Near somewhere
Equipment Used
Mamiya 645, 210mm lens
Exposure
8 sec @f/22
Film & Developer
Ilford FP4+, Pyrocat-HD 2+2+100
Paper & Developer
Ilford MGIV, Ansco 130
